    DEPARTMENT OF ENVIRONMENTAL PROTECTION

    RULE NO.:RULE TITLE:

    62-701.500Landfill Operation Requirements

    The Florida Department of Environmental Protection hereby gives notice that it has issued an order on April 15, 2015, granting Lake Worth Drainage Districts Petition for a Waiver. The Petition was received on December 31, 2014. Notice of receipt of this Petition was published in the Florida Administrative Register on January 5, 2015. The Petition requested a waiver from paragraphs 62-701.500(7)(a), (7)(c) and (7)(e), Florida Administrative Code (F.A.C.), which require Class III landfills provide weekly compaction, side slopes no greater than three feet horizontal to one foot vertical rise (3:1) during operation, and weekly cover. No public comment was received. The Order, file number 15-001, granted the Petition to Rule 62-701.500, F.A.C., based on a showing that Petitioner demonstrated that a strict application of the rule would result in substantial hardship to Petitioner or would affect Petitioner differently than other similarly situated applicants and because Petitioner demonstrated that the purpose of the underlying statute will be or has been achieved by other means.
